G5 Fractions, Decimals and Percentage Quiz

1) A motorbike travels at a speed of 40 km/h.
What is the reciprocal of the motorbike’s speed in meters per second?

2 / 20

2) A farmer harvested 10.6 tons of rice.
If he sold 4.3 tons, how many tons of rice does he have left?

3 / 20

3) If 40% of a number is 24, what is 75% of that number?

4 / 20

4) An athlete ran 5 1/2 km in 1/2 hour.
What is his average speed in km/h?

5 / 20

5) A machine produces 3.625 units/min.
How many units will it produce in 3 hours 20 minutes?

6 / 20

6) A school has 800 students.
0.6 of the students are girls.
How many girls are there in the school?

7 / 20

7) In a school, 2/3 of students play football and 1/4 of students play cricket.
How many more students play football than cricket if total number of students are 60?

8 / 20

8) A bike travels at a speed of 50 km/h.
What is the bike’s speed in meters per second?

9 / 20

9) If 5/6 of a number is 25, what is 40% of that number?

10 / 20

10) A tank is filled with 3/8 of water.
If the tank can hold 40 liters of water, how much water is in the tank?

11 / 20

11) John had 3/4 of a pizza. He shared it equally among his 6 friends.
How much pizza did each friend get?

12 / 20

12) A garden is divided into 5 equal sections.
Each section has 3/8 acre of land.
How much land is there in the entire garden?

13 / 20

13) A book costs ₹49.75.
A discount of 15.5% is offered.
What is the final price paid for 2 such books after discount?

14 / 20

14) A rope is 4.5 meters long.
How many centimeters is this?

15 / 20

15) A restaurant bill is $75.
If the tip rate is 0.25, how much should be left as a tip?

16 / 20

16) What is the decimal equivalent of the fraction 6/10?

17 / 20

17) A recipe calls for 3/4 cup of flour and 1/2 cup of sugar.
How much flour and sugar are needed in total?

18 / 20

18) 23.205 + 0.5 =

19 / 20

19) Sam’s mom baked a cake.
She divided it into 8 equal slices.
Sam ate 3 slices.
What fraction of the cake did Sam eat?

20 / 20

20) A recipe calls for 0.75 cups of sugar.
One tablespoon carries sugar equivalent to 0.05 cup.
How many tablespoons is this?
